当前位置:首页 > 热门大瓜 > 正文

java视频网站源码,架构设计、功能模块与关键技术揭秘

亲爱的读者,你是否曾梦想过拥有一个属于自己的Java视频网站?想象每天有成千上万的观众涌入你的平台,观看你精心挑选的视频内容。这听起来是不是很酷?别急,今天我就要带你深入探索Java视频网站源码的秘密,让你离梦想更近一步!

一、Java视频网站源码的魅力

Java视频网站源码,顾名思义,就是用Java语言编写的视频网站的全部代码。它包含了网站的前端界面、后端逻辑、数据库设计等所有组成部分。选择Java视频网站源码,主要有以下几个原因:

1. 跨平台性:Java语言具有跨平台的特点,这意味着你的网站可以在任何支持Java的操作系统上运行。

2. 成熟的技术栈:Java拥有丰富的技术栈,包括Spring、Hibernate、MyBatis等,这些框架可以帮助你快速搭建网站。

3. 强大的社区支持:Java社区庞大,遇到问题时,你可以在社区中找到解决方案。

二、如何选择合适的Java视频网站源码

市面上有很多Java视频网站源码,如何选择一个适合自己的呢?以下是一些建议:

1. 功能需求:明确你的网站需要哪些功能,如视频上传、播放、评论、搜索等。

2. 技术栈:了解源码所使用的技术栈,确保你熟悉这些技术。

3. 社区活跃度:查看源码的GitHub仓库,了解社区的活跃度,这有助于你解决问题。

4. 文档完善度:一个完善的文档可以帮助你更好地理解和使用源码。

三、搭建Java视频网站源码的步骤

1. 环境搭建:安装Java开发环境、数据库、IDE等。

2. 下载源码:从GitHub或其他平台下载源码。

3. 配置数据库:根据源码中的配置文件,设置数据库连接信息。

4. 编译源码:使用IDE编译源码,生成可执行文件。

5. 部署网站:将可执行文件部署到服务器,配置域名和端口。

6. 测试网站:在本地或服务器上测试网站功能,确保一切正常。

四、Java视频网站源码的优化

1. 性能优化:针对数据库查询、页面渲染等进行优化,提高网站性能。

2. 安全性优化:加强网站的安全性,防止SQL注入、XSS攻击等。

3. 用户体验优化:优化网站界面,提高用户体验。

五、Java视频网站源码的未来

随着互联网的不断发展,Java视频网站源码也将不断进化。以下是一些未来趋势:

1. 人工智能:利用人工智能技术,实现智能推荐、视频识别等功能。

2. 区块链:利用区块链技术,提高版权保护、去中心化存储等。

3. 5G技术:随着5G技术的普及,视频网站将提供更流畅的观看体验。

亲爱的读者,通过本文的介绍,相信你对Java视频网站源码有了更深入的了解。现在,就让我们一起迈向梦想,打造属于自己的视频网站吧!加油!

推荐文章

最新文章

取消
扫码支持 支付码